Abstract
The invention belongs to finance device field, a kind of specifically gate mechanism applied to coin exchange equipment, including support frame, funnel, conduit, upper cover plate, lower cover and axle, funnel and conduit are separately mounted on support frame, are setting up and down, axle is rotatably installed on support frame, upper cover plate is reciprocally slidably mounted on support frame, positioned at the top of funnel, and lower cover is reciprocally slidably mounted on support frame, sliding trace is between funnel and conduit;Upper cover plate and lower cover are connected by connecting rod with axle respectively, synchronous slide, and upper cover plate is opposite with lower cover glide direction.The present invention by alternate reciprocating motion between upper cover plate and lower cover, is realized using connecting rod and first places coin, after by the equipment of coin conveying;Successively orderly action is reasonable, and can quantify coin is transported in equipment, facilitates resume module, efficiently realizes exchange, avoids mass of coins and is deposited in module and causes catching phenomenon.

Embodiment
The invention will be further described below in conjunction with the accompanying drawings.
As shown in Figure 1 and Figure 2, the present invention includes support frame 101, funnel 102, conduit 103, upper cover plate 104, lower cover 108
And axle 111, wherein support frame 101 is " U "-shaped, and funnel 102 is separately mounted on support frame 101 with conduit 103,103, conduit
In the underface of funnel 102;Funnel 102 and conduit 103 are located at the both sides up and down of the bottom plate of support frame 101, and the bottom of support frame 101
Part on plate between funnel 102 and conduit 103 is opening 119.The both sides of the open top end of support frame 101 are respectively and fixedly connected with
There is upper slide rail 114, upper cover plate 104 is located at the top of funnel 102, has been respectively and fixedly connected with the both sides of the lower surface of upper cover plate 104 sliding
Block 117, the top shoe 117 of both sides and the upper slide rail 114 of the open top end both sides of support frame 101 are respectively positioned on Lou on upper cover plate 104
The left and right sides of bucket 102, the top shoe 117 of the both sides upper cunning with the open top end both sides of support frame 101 respectively on upper cover plate 104
Rail 114 is slidably connected, and upper cover plate 104 is reciprocatingly slided by top shoe 117 along upper slide rail 114, realizes the closure of funnel 102.
The lower section of upper cover plate 104 is provided with axle 111, and the axle 111 is located at the inner side of funnel 102, the both ends rotational installation of axle 111
Fixed on support frame 101, and with back-up ring.The lower section of axle 111 is provided with lower cover 108, and the both sides of the lower cover 108 are fixed respectively
There is sliding block 113, the top of sliding block 113 is respectively equipped with a glidepath 115 in both sides, and the glidepath 115 in left side is solid by a left side
Fixed board 106 is fixed in the inner left wall of support frame 101, and the glidepath 115 on right side is fixed in support frame by right fixed plate 116
101 right side inwall;The sliding block 103 of the both sides of lower cover 108 and the glidepath 115 of both sides are located at funnel 102 and conduit respectively
103 left and right sides, the glidepath 115 of the sliding blocks 103 of the both sides of lower cover 108 respectively with both sides are slidably connected, lower cover 108
Reciprocatingly slided by sliding block 103 along glidepath 115, sliding trace realizes funnel 102 between funnel 102 and conduit 103
With the closure between conduit 103.
Upper cover plate 104 and lower cover 108 are connected by upper connecting rod 109 and lower link 110 with axle 111 respectively, upper connecting rod 109
And lower link 110 respectively has two, respectively positioned at the left and right sides of funnel 102 and conduit 103, one end point of each upper connecting rod 109
Not be hinged by bearing pin 112 with upper cover plate 104, the other end of each upper connecting rod 109 passes through flat key and the key connection of axle 111 respectively.
One end of each lower link 110 is be hinged by bearing pin 112 with lower cover 108 respectively, and the other end of each lower link 110 leads to respectively
Cross flat key and the key connection of axle 111.Two upper connecting rods 109 are parallel to each other, and are overlapped in the projection of perpendicular;Two lower links
110 are parallel to each other, and are overlapped in the projection of perpendicular;Also, also it is parallel to each other between upper connecting rod 109 and lower link 110, and
The upper connecting rod 109 of the same side is conllinear in the projection of perpendicular with the length direction of lower link 110.Upper cover plate 104 and lower cover
108 synchronous slides, and glide direction is opposite;That is, when upper cover plate 104 is located at the top of funnel 102, gate mechanism is in closed form
During state, outside of the lower cover 108 between funnel 102 and conduit 103, opened between funnel 102 and conduit 103;When upper lid
Top of the plate 104 away from funnel 102, when gate mechanism is in opening, lower cover 108 be located at funnel 102 and conduit 103 it
Between, closed between funnel 102 and conduit 103.
Travel switch bracket 107 is connected with the inwall of support frame 101, the trip switch bracket 107 is opened provided with stroke
Close 118.The handle 105 for being easy to upper and lower cover plate 104,108 to slide also is connected with upper cover plate 104.
The present invention operation principle be:
As shown in figure 3, gate mechanism original state is closure state, upper cover plate 104 is located at the top of funnel 102, lower cover
Plate 108 is away between funnel 102 and conduit 103.When upper cover plate 104 is opened by handle 105, top shoe 117, sliding block
113 enter line slip along upper slide rail 114, glidepath 115 respectively;Upper cover plate 104 driven during opening upper connecting rod 109 by by
One side for being laterally away from funnel 102 of nearly funnel 102 rotates around axle 111, and upper connecting rod 109 drives lower link 110 by axle 111
Synchronous axial system, now in opened condition, lower cover 108 is anti-with upper cover plate 104 under the drive of lower link 110 for the top of funnel 102
Direction is slided between the bottom of funnel 102 and the top of conduit 103, and conduit 103 is in closure state.
By coin be put into funnel 102 it is inner after, by handle 105 upper cover plate 104 is closed when, top shoe 117, sliding block
113 respectively along upper slide rail 114, the opposite direction of glidepath 115 slide, upper cover plate 104 driven during closure upper connecting rod 109 by
The side of a laterally closer funnel 102 away from funnel 102 rotates around axle 111, and upper connecting rod 109 drives lower link by axle 111
110 synchronous axial systems, now the top of funnel 102 is in closure state, and lower cover 108 is under the drive of lower link 110, by funnel 102
Removed between conduit 103, now in opened condition, coin is entered in equipment the bottom of funnel 102 by conduit 103;Upper lid
Plate 104 touches travel switch 118 in closure, and travel switch 118 is opened, and the coin receiving module in coin exchange equipment is received
To instruction, into working condition, thus process realizes that coin is continuously entered in coin exchange equipment, realizes coin exchange industry
Business.
